WebYes, chickens can eat tuna. Tuna contains crucial nutrients like proteins and vitamins that are beneficial for your flock. However, too much tuna could be lethal for your chickens. Some tuna contains mercury which can make your chicken sick. If fed in moderation, tunas are a wonderful food source. I have fed them rib cages taken from the filets, with bones. Never had a hen choke, never … WebSep 30, 2015 · The chickens cannot physically eat the bones, so the bones aren’t a danger to them. What your chickens will do is peck off all the bits of meat, fat, skin and soft tissues you’ve left behind. In other words, the chickens will pick the bones clean. WebMar 2, 2024 · Fish absorb mercury from contaminated water, and when chickens eat fish, they can absorb some of the mercury as well. Mercury contamination can cause a variety of health problems in both humans and animals, including neurological problems, developmental delays, and heart disease.
